Mechanics and payout math: Roulette on CS2 skin sites

When evaluating เว็บเดิมพันสกิน CS2 roulette, use these criteria to avoid "looks fair, pays unfair" setups and to control exposure.
- Payout mapping transparency: the site should show exact multipliers for each color/number/tier before you bet (not only after spins).
- Wheel composition clarity: you should be able to see how many outcomes exist and how each maps to payouts (the edge lives here).
- RNG + seed workflow: provably fair should include server seed, client seed, nonce, and a verification page.
- Bet limits and increments: tight max bets reduce "one-spin ruin"; clear increments reduce accidental overbetting with skins.
- Spin pace controls: autoplay and fast spins increase loss velocity; good sites offer cooldowns and configurable delays.
- Return policy on disconnected rounds: rules for timeouts, trade errors, or disconnects must be explicit.
- Liquidity and pricing: deposit/withdraw skin valuation should be consistent; wide spreads silently raise your effective cost.
- Bonus and wagering constraints: roulette often has restrictions; check if certain bets "don't count" or have reduced contribution.

Jackpot pools: contribution models, expected value, and timing
Jackpot outcomes depend on your share of the pool and how the pool changes before the roll. Use scenario-based rules so you do not "buy a ticket" into a pool that is about to become worse for you.
- If the pool can change up to the last second and you see frequent last-moment large entries, then avoid small early entries; either enter late with a defined cap or skip the round.
- If the site uses unclear skin valuation or frequent "price updates," then treat jackpot EV as unknown; prefer formats with fixed odds (coinflip) until pricing is stable.
- If jackpot fees are taken from winners (or from the pool) and not clearly displayed, then assume your payout is lower than expected and avoid close-margin entries.
- If the platform shows full round history (entries, odds over time, final roll + verification), then you can time entries to match your risk target (smaller share for entertainment, larger share only when bankroll allows).
- If you notice repeating patterns of the same accounts entering late and winning disproportionately, then treat it as a red flag (possible collusion, bonus abuse, or privileged info) and move to another site.
Security, fairness and provable randomness across platforms
Use this quick selection algorithm before you decide which เว็บเดิมพันสกิน CS2 ดีที่สุด for you. It prioritizes "can I verify outcomes and get skins out?" over flashy game menus.
- Confirm provable fairness is actually verifiable: find the verification page, run at least one completed round through it, and ensure seeds/nonces match the shown outcome.
- Check withdrawal reality: review withdrawal method, expected delays, and whether the site has enough tradable inventory (or uses instant trade bots you can inspect).
- Inspect trade security: verify correct Steam trade URL handling, bot identity checks, and clear instructions to prevent impersonation scams.
- Validate pricing consistency: compare the same item's value on deposit vs withdrawal; large gaps act like hidden fees.
- Review dispute rules: look for explicit policies for stuck trades, cancelled matches, disconnects, and bot downtime.
- Assess account protections: 2FA support, session/device management, and transparent login security reduce takeover risk.
- Test with a small round-trip: deposit a low-value item, place one small bet, then withdraw; only scale up after a clean cycle.

Quick clarifications for informed choices
Is roulette or coinflip safer on a CS2 skin betting site?
Coinflip is usually easier to control because odds and stake are straightforward. Roulette can amplify chasing behavior due to fast spins and streak perception.
What does "provably fair" actually protect me from?
It helps you verify that outcomes were generated from declared seeds rather than altered after bets. It does not guarantee fair pricing, smooth withdrawals, or protection from scams.
How do I test a เว็บเดิมพันสกิน CS2 before depositing high-value skins?
Do a small deposit, place one minimal bet, then withdraw immediately. Only scale after a complete, problem-free round-trip.
Are jackpots beatable by timing the pool?
Timing can improve decision quality (entering only when odds match your risk cap), but it does not remove variance or fees. If valuation or fees are unclear, treat EV as unknown and avoid.
Why do coinflip sessions feel "rigged" during losing streaks?
High variance creates long streaks even with fair odds, and rapid rounds make them more noticeable. Use fixed stakes and session limits to prevent tilt-driven escalation.
What are the biggest red flags when comparing sites?
Unverifiable fairness claims, inconsistent skin pricing, unclear withdrawal rules, and missing dispute policies are major warnings. Also avoid sites where you cannot identify and verify trade bots.
